The only government polytechnic in Siliguri, established in 1995 and affiliated with the West Bengal State Council of Technical & Vocational Education and Skill Development (WBSCTVESD). Offers diploma programmes in Civil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Electronics & Telecommunication Engineering, Electronics & Instrumentation Engineering, Computer Science & Technology, and Architecture Assistantship, plus a Diploma in Pharmacy (D.Pharm). AICTE approved and NAAC accredited with an ‘A’ grade — by far the most affordable quality diploma option in North Bengal, with admission through the JEXPO entrance exam.

Part of the well-established Siliguri Institute of Technology campus (founded 1999) on Hill Cart Road, Sukna. The diploma wing offers Civil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Electronics & Telecommunication Engineering, Computer Science & Technology, and Diploma in Hotel Management & Catering Technology. Being part of a larger private engineering & management campus gives diploma students access to shared labs, workshops, and a wider placement network than a standalone polytechnic.

What is a Polytechnic Diploma?

A Polytechnic Diploma is a 3-year technical programme after Class 10 that builds hands-on engineering skills across branches like Civil, Electrical, Electronics & Computer Science. In West Bengal, admission is primarily through JEXPO (Joint Entrance Exam for Polytechnics), with lateral entry via VOCLET for ITI/vocational diploma holders.

Admission 2026

Eligibility, Fees & Admission Process

Eligibility Criteria

  • Passed Class 10 (Madhyamik or equivalent) with Science & Mathematics
  • Minimum 35% aggregate (relaxation for SC/ST/OBC)
  • Must appear for JEXPO (regular entry)
  • ITI/Vocational diploma holders: apply via VOCLET lateral entry
  • Class 12 (Science) students: lateral entry to 2nd year directly

Admission Process

  • Step 1: Appear for JEXPO/VOCLET entrance exam
  • Step 2: Register on the WBSCTVESD counselling portal
  • Step 3: Fill college & branch preferences
  • Step 4: Seat allotment based on rank & preferences
  • Exam Window: JEXPO usually held April–May
  • Counselling: June–August 2026

🎓 Higher Studies Option
Diploma holders can pursue a B.Tech via JELET lateral entry, joining directly into the 2nd year of an engineering degree — skipping the first year entirely. This makes a Polytechnic Diploma a practical, low-cost stepping stone toward a full engineering degree rather than a terminal qualification.

Siliguri’s role as the primary gateway to Darjeeling, Sikkim, Bhutan and North-East India has driven sustained investment in roads, bridges, power and telecom infrastructure. This creates consistent regional demand for diploma-holding site supervisors, junior engineers and technicians — particularly in Civil and Electrical branches — across both government (PWD, PHE) and private construction & infrastructure contractors.
